I hope someone can help with this one. I ordered my sons travel system from the pram centre as this allows you to pay up the cost over time.

When I had made all payments they called to ask if I wanted the items delivered before the baby came and as I was off work at the time I agreed.

I just started using the stroller part of the travel system at the start of December and when I folded the pram I realised that one side wasn't clipped in. The problem is definitely with the stroller attachment as the car seat clips in both sides no problems.

I contacted the pram centre to be told that there is only a 6 month warranty so the pram is no longer covered. I wasn't told this when they offered early delivery as I wouldn't have agreed to this. My son was just 6 months on 19th December so if I hadn't agreed to early delivery it would still have been covered.

They offered to check the fitting if I could bring it into the shop but I don't drive and it's not safe to take on public transport.

Is this legal? I thought everything was 12 months and even if 6 months is legal should they not have informed me of that when asking me to accept the item early?
